The Vine Church, Church building in Wan Chai, Hong Kong.
The Vine Church is a church building in Wan Chai, Hong Kong, occupying several floors of the Vine Centre at 29 Burrows Street. The building contains a main worship hall alongside rooms used for community gatherings and group activities.
The church was founded in 1997 and over the years grew into a well-established congregation in Wan Chai. It gradually expanded its space and activities to meet the needs of a growing community.
The Vine Church holds services with contemporary rock music, giving the space a relaxed and open feel. The congregation brings together people from many different nationalities, reflecting the mixed character of Wan Chai.
The building sits in Wan Chai and is easy to reach by public transport, with several metro and bus stops nearby. Current service times and other practical details are available through the church's online channels.
The church runs support programs for asylum seekers in the city, making it one of the few congregations in Hong Kong to actively work with this group. This work happens alongside regular church life and is a visible part of its daily activities.
